  • Publication number: 20110027441
    Abstract: A method of sterilizing a liquid food product includes flowing a food product to be sterilized through an input channel. The method also includes flowing the liquid food product through a heating channel that is fluidly coupled to the input channel. Further, the method includes flowing the food product through an output channel fluidly coupled to the heating channel. The output channel is adjacent the input channel, and the output channel, the input channel, and the heating channel are all integrated portions of a heat exchanger. Further still, the method includes transferring heat between the output channel and the input channel.
